Difficulties Encountered by Arabic-Speaking Undergraduate and Graduate English Language Students in Interpreting English Formulaic Expressions
Bibliographic record
Abstract
This study investigates the difficulties that undergraduate and graduate students of English language encounter intheir interpretation and translation of English idiomatic/formulaic expressions into Arabic. Since the majority ofthese idiomatic expressions (referred to hereafter as IEs) in English or any other language potentially have morethan one interpretation, it has been assumed that these expressions constitute a major problem for non-nativespeakers of English, particularly for those who do not have adequate semantic and pragmatic competence in thetarget culture.The interpretation/translation task used in this study consists of three English formulaic expressions deliberatelyselected to measure both undergraduate and graduate students’ semantic and pragmatic competence ininterpreting/translating these formulaic expressions. The results of this study are based on the writteninterpretation/translation and the informal solicitation of responses from 83 undergraduate students of Englishlanguage and 13 graduate students of Applied Linguistics and Translation.The disparity in the students' performance on the interpretation task that was administered to both groupsunequivocally verified the claim that 'inter-lingual transfer’ occurs when foreign students are called upon totranslate from their mother tongue to a foreign language; and that acquiring adequate competence in thepragmatics of the target language and culture is highly essential for the acquisition of literacy and avoidance ofmisinterpretation of such expressions (Gass & Selinker, 1983; Odlin, 1989; Kharma & Hajjaj,1997; Mahmoud,2002).The findings of this study indicate that graduate students have done overwhelmingly well in comparison withtheir undergraduate counterparts. This is probably due to their continued training in translating material to andfrom the target language and culture. The findings have also emphasized the importance of providing studentswith adequate training in pragmatics, intercultural communication, and translation.
